OTC consumer health market is estimated to be valued at USD 212.1 Bn in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 286.71 Bn,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.4% from 2025 to 2032. 



Key Takeaways

• Dominating Region: North America – accounted for nearly 38% of global market revenue in 2024, driven by high OTC Consumer Health Market share in analgesics and extensive retail networks.

•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ific – recorded a 6.3% growth rate in 2025, propelled by e-pharmacy expansion in China and India.

• Product Type Segment:

- Analgesics (dominant): Johnson & Johnson's pain relief portfolio generated over USD 15 Bn in 2024.

- Vitamins & Minerals (fastest-growing): Abbott's Ensure line expanded by 14% in 2025, showcasing strong market growth strategies.

• Distribution Channel Segment:

- Drug Stores (dominant): contributed the majority of market revenue in 2024, underscoring traditional channel resilience.

- E-Commerce (fastest-growing): witnessed an 18% year-on-year increase in 2024 led by partnership between Unilever and Amazon.



Market Key Trends

Digital transformation in distribution and personalized self-care is the foremost market trend reshaping the OTC Consumer Health Market. In 2024, e-commerce sales of OTC products grew by 15%. In early 2025, the U.S. FDA introduced streamlined telepharmacy guidelines, a key policy update facilitating remote prescription verification for over-the-counter remedies. This regulatory change acts as a primary market driver, reducing market restraints related to in-store consultations and logistics. Such market trends signal an expanding opportunity for brands to deploy omnichannel loyalty programs, real-time supply-chain tracking, and targeted digital marketing. Addressing supply-chain constraints through blockchain pilots—launched by Bayer AG in late 2024—has also improved traceability and minimized counterfeit risk. As companies refine their market growth strategies around data analytics and telehealth partnerships, the industry is poised for sustained momentum through 2032.

Strategies Adopted by Key Players:

Johnson & Johnson partnered with a leading telehealth platform in early 2025 to introduce a next-generation analgesic patch, resulting in an 8% uplift in quarterly market revenue. Abbott Laboratories expanded its e-commerce footprint in Asia Pacific through a joint venture with a major online retailer in mid-2024, boosting OTC Consumer Health Market share in vitamins & minerals by 12%. Sanofi's launch of a personalized nutrition app in late 2024 leveraged AI-driven consumer insights, increasing user retention rates by 18%.
